In the realm of packaging for sensitive materials, particularly in industries like electronics, pharmaceuticals, and aerospace, a multi-layered approach to moisture control is often the most effective. This approach typically involves the synergistic use of three key components: Moisture Barrier Bags (MBBs), desiccants, and Humidity Indicator Cards (HICs). The Pillars of Moisture Protection:

  1. Moisture Barrier Bags (MBBs): These are specialized packaging materials engineered to significantly reduce the rate at which moisture vapor can pass through them. MBBs are constructed with multiple layers of films, often including aluminum foil or metallized polyester, to create an extremely low Moisture Vapor Transmission Rate (MVTR). They act as the primary physical barrier against external humidity.
  2. Desiccants: Desiccants are materials that have a high affinity for water and absorb moisture from the surrounding air. Commonly made from silica gel, activated clay, or molecular sieves, desiccants are placed inside the MBB along with the product. Their role is to absorb any residual moisture within the sealed bag or any moisture that might slowly permeate through the MBB over time.
  3. Humidity Indicator Cards (HICs): HICs are the visual verification tools. Placed within the MBB, they provide a simple, at-a-glance indication of the internal relative humidity (RH). Their color-changing spots alert users whether the internal environment remains dry or if moisture levels have risen above a critical threshold.

How They Work Together: A Three-Pronged Defense

The effectiveness of this system lies in its layered defense against moisture:

  • Initial Sealing: When products are packed, they are placed inside an MBB with the appropriate amount of desiccant. The bag is then sealed, ideally using a vacuum sealer to remove as much moist air as possible before sealing.
  • Absorption and Containment: The MBB acts as the first line of defense, minimizing external moisture ingress. The desiccant then works to absorb any residual moisture trapped inside the bag and any trace amounts that might permeate through the barrier.
  • Constant Monitoring: The HIC placed inside the bag continuously monitors the RH. If the desiccant is working effectively and the MBB is intact, the HIC's spots will remain in their original color state (typically blue), indicating a dry environment.
  • Alerting to Problems: If the MBB is compromised (e.g., a faulty seal) or the desiccant becomes saturated, moisture levels inside the bag will rise. The HIC will then change color, providing a visual alert that the protective environment has been breached. This allows users to take corrective action, such as repacking with fresh desiccant or inspecting the product.

Key Benefits of the Synergistic Approach:

  • Enhanced Product Integrity: This combined system offers superior protection against moisture-induced damage, crucial for sensitive components where even minor humidity can be detrimental.
  • Extended Shelf Life: By maintaining optimal humidity levels consistently, this system directly contributes to extending the shelf life and ensuring the performance of products.
  • Cost-Effectiveness: While seemingly complex, this system is highly cost-effective when compared to the potential costs of product failure, returns, and reputational damage.
  • Compliance: For industries with strict regulatory requirements, this comprehensive approach ensures compliance with standards related to moisture control and product handling.
